大家好,今天来为大家分享ip *** 怎么判断的一些知识点,和如何判断ip *** 是否正确的问题解析,大家要是都明白,那么可以忽略,如果不太清楚的话可以看看本篇文章,相信很大概率可以解决您的问题,接下来我们就一起来看看吧!
本文目录
- 如何区分IP *** 的类别
- 怎么判 *** 脑上网ip *** 是公网还是私网的
- 如何判断两个ip *** 在同一个网段
- bat判断IP来更换IP ***
- 怎么判断自己的电脑是属于哪个网段的
- 如何判断一个ip的 *** 和主机
一、如何区分IP *** 的类别
IP *** 根据其 *** 部分的长度和主机部分的长度,可以划分为不同的类别。根据经典的分类 *** ,IP *** 被分为5类,分别是A类、B类、C类、D类、E类。其中A、B、C三类被广泛使用,D类和E类则用于特殊目的。
下面是每个IP *** 类别的特征和其范围的简要概述:
A类 *** :以0开头,之一个字节为 *** 部分,后三个字节为主机部分。A类 *** 可用于大型 *** ,最多可容纳126个 *** ,每个 *** 最多可容纳16777214个主机。
范围:0.0.0.0~ 127.255.255.255
B类 *** :以10开头,前两个字节为 *** 部分,后两个字节为主机部分。B类 *** 可用于中等规模的 *** ,最多可容纳16384个 *** ,每个 *** 最多可容纳65534个主机。
范围:128.0.0.0~ 191.255.255.255
C类 *** :以110开头,前三个字节为 *** 部分,最后一个字节为主机部分。C类 *** 可用于小型 *** ,最多可容纳2^21个 *** ,每个 *** 最多可容纳254个主机。
范围:1 *** .0.0.0~ 223.255.255.255
D类 *** :以1110开头,前4个字节为组播 *** ,用于支持多播协议。
范围:224.0.0.0~ 239.255.255.255
E类 *** :以11110开头,保留 *** ,用于实验和研究。
范围:240.0.0.0~ 255.255.255.255
下面是一个图表,展示了不同IP *** 类别的范围和二进制格式:
二、怎么判 *** 脑上网ip *** 是公网还是私网的
根据连接方式判断。公网IP *** 是直接连接互联网的,而私网IP *** 则是通过各种方式连接公网 *** ,从而获得 *** 。
例如:你家的电脑直接连接互联网,就是公网 *** 。而其他通过路由器等方式连接你家电脑,从而获得的 *** *** 的,就是私网 *** 。
公网、内网是两种Internet的接入方式。公网接入方式:上网的计算机得到的IP *** 是Internet上的非保留 *** ,公网的计算机和Internet上的其他计算机可随意互相访问。
1、A类:1.0.0.0到 127.255.255.255主要分配给大量主机而局域网 *** 数量较少的大型 ***
2、B类:128.0.0.0到191.255.255.255一般用于国际 *** 大公司和 *** 机构
3、C类:1 *** .0.0.0到223.255.255.255用于一般小公司校园网研究机构等
4、D类:224.0.0.0到 239.255.255.255用于特殊用途,又称做广播 ***
5、E类:240.0.0.0到255.255.255.255暂时保留
私用ip *** :以上各类 *** 中有以下做为私用 ***
1、A类:10.0.0.0到 10.255.255.255
2、B类:172.16.0.0到172.31.255.255
3、C类:1 *** .168.0.0到1 *** .168.255.255
其中127.0.0.0到127.255.255.255为 *** 环回 *** 。
三、如何判断两个ip *** 在同一个网段
1.将两个IP *** 与 *** 掩码转换为二进制形式。
2.将两个IP *** 与 *** 掩码进行按位与运算,得到的结果就是 *** *** 。
3.检查两个IP *** 是否在这个 *** *** 的范围内。如果都在这个范围内,那么这两个IP *** 就在同一网段内。
例如,我们有两个IP *** :1 *** .168.1.10和1 *** .168.1.20, *** 掩码为255.255.255.0。我们可以将这两个IP *** 和 *** 掩码转换为二进制形式,然后进行按位与运算:
IP *** 1 *** .168.1.10的二进制形式为XXXXXXXXX 10101000 00000010 00000001
IP *** 1 *** .168.1.20的二进制形式为XXXXXXXXX 10101000 00000110 00000010
*** 掩码的二进制形式为 11111111 11111111 11111111 00000000
将这三个IP *** 和 *** 掩码进行按位与运算,得到的结果为XXXXXXXXX XXXXXXXXX XXXXXXXXX XXXXXXXXX(x为一位数字),这就是 *** *** 。所以这两个IP *** 都在同一网段内。
注意:在进行按位与运算时,如果某个IP *** 的 *** 部分和主机部分都为零或都为二五五,那么这个IP *** 就是广播 *** 。在进行比较时,需要排除广播 *** 的影响。
四、bat判断IP来更换IP ***
1.脚本使用 `for/f`命令解析 `ipconfig`的输出,查找包含"IP Address"的行。
2.设置变量 `ip`来存储提取的 IP *** 。
3.如果 IP *** 的第二部分是 1 *** .0.0.211,则跳转到标签 `:nei`。
4.如果 IP *** 是 123.123.123.111,则跳转到标签 `:wai`。
5.如果以上条件都不满足,则退出脚本。
6.在标签 `:wai`中,使用 `netsh`命令更改本地连接的 IP *** 为 1 *** .0.0.211,子网掩码为 255.255.255.0,默认 *** 为 1 *** .0.0. *** 。
7.设置 DNS服务器 *** 为 202.102.224.68。
8.添加备用 DNS服务器 *** 为 202.102.227.68。
9.在标签 `:nei`中,更改本地连接的 IP *** 为 123.123.123.6,清除默认 *** ,并清除 DNS服务器 *** 。
10.脚本使用 `goto`命令跳转,以实现 IP *** 的动态更换。
注意:此脚本可能需要根据实际 *** 环境进行调整,以确保正确更改 IP *** 。此外,运行此类脚本可能需要管理员权限。
五、怎么判断自己的电脑是属于哪个网段的
判断一台电脑属于哪个网段,可以通过以下步骤进行:
查看电脑的IP *** 和子网掩码:在电脑的命令提示符(Windows)或终端(Mac/Linux)中输入“ipconfig”命令,可以查看电脑的IP *** 和子网掩码。
根据IP *** 和子网掩码计算网段:将IP *** 和子网掩码进行与运算,可以得到 *** *** ,从而确定网段。例如,如果IP *** 是1 *** .168.1.1,子网掩码是255.255.255.0,那么 *** *** 就是1 *** .168.1.0,网段就是1 *** .168.1.*。
查看路由表:在电脑的命令提示符(Windows)或终端(Mac/Linux)中输入“route print”命令,可以查看路由表。路由表中的 *** *** 就是该电脑所属的网段。
如果以上 *** 无法确定电脑所属的网段,还可以通过以下 *** 进行判断:
查看 *** 配置文件:在Windows *** 中,可以查看 *** 配置文件(如“networkconfig.ini”文件)来获取IP *** 和子网掩码等信息。
查看 *** 接口卡属 *** :在Windows *** 中,可以右键点击 *** 连接图标,选择“属 *** ”查看 *** 接口卡的属 *** ,其中包括IP *** 和子网掩码等信息。
需要注意的是,以上 *** 只能判 *** 脑所属的局域网网段,无法判 *** 脑所属的广域网网段。
六、如何判断一个ip的 *** 和主机
IP *** 的 *** 号和主机号是通过子网掩码来计算的。具体计算 *** 如下:
有一个C类 *** 为: 1 *** .9.200.13其缺省的子网掩码为:
IP *** 1 *** .9.200.13,转换为二进制11000000000010011 *** 0000001101,
子网掩码255.255.255.0,转换为二进制11111111111111111111111100000000,
它的 *** 号计算 *** :将两个二进制数做按位与(&)运算后得出的结果即为 *** 号,
11000000000010011 *** 0000001101
& 11111111111111111111111100000000
-------------------------------------------------------------
11000000000010011 *** 0000000000=1 *** .9.200.
它的主机号计算 *** :将子网掩码取反再与IP *** 按位与(&)后得到的结果即为主机号,
11000000000010011 *** 0000001101
00000000000000000000000011111111
------------------------------------------------------------
00000000000000000000000000001101=0.0.0.13即主机号为13(或者0.0.0.13)。
IP *** 是TCP/IP *** 中用来唯一标识每台主机或设备的 *** ,IP *** 由32位(共四个八位组)的二进制组成。IP *** 分为两部分,左边 *** 编号部分用来标识主机所在的 *** ;右边部分用来标识主机本身,这部分称为主机 *** 。连接到同一 *** 的主机必须拥有相同的 *** 编号。
一个 IP *** 的 *** 部分被称为 *** 号或者 *** *** ,主机可以与具有相同的 *** 号的设备直接通讯,在没有连接设备的情况下,即使共享相同的物理网段, *** 号不同则无法进行通讯,IP
*** 的 *** *** 使路由器可以将分组置于正确的网段上
*** *** 号后的主机号可以使路由器能够二层帧封装的分组传送到 *** 上的一台特定的主机,使主机号与
*** 进行正确的映射中的关键问题在于使用子网掩码来确定或者获取远程主机的 *** *** 信息。 *** *** 之后的部分为主机 *** 。
关于ip *** 怎么判断到此分享完毕,希望能帮助到您。